Skip to content

Add Unity Multiplay sdk #808

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 7 commits into from
Jun 12, 2024

Conversation

GabrielBoninUnity
Copy link
Contributor

@GabrielBoninUnity GabrielBoninUnity commented May 30, 2024

Hi there. My name is Gabriel, and I represent the engineering team at Unity. We would like to add our multiplayer services, Multiplay, to your SDK list. Here is a quick list of games on Steam that use Multiplay.

https://steamdb.info/app/945360/
https://steamdb.info/app/307950/
https://steamdb.info/app/1446230/

We hope that this addition will improve and give more dept to your amazing project.
Thanks

Gabriel

@SteamDB-Tracker
Copy link
Member

After running changed rules in this pull request (this bot only tests rules.ini changes):

Changed technologies: SDK.Multiplay

These apps now match: (42) 285900 823130 955870 1210380 1327570 1452550 1673670 1953560 2140750 2179290 2189120 2192900 2210800 2246580 2264360 2279580 2283560 2311970 2321390 2407560 2478480 2501340 2529450 2546200 2549580 2596750 2614160 2615220 2617350 2693650 2715390 2726200 2747470 2754270 2763960 2769590 2777410 2810710 2842470 2843960 2916690 2927690

Please confirm that all these changed apps are correct.

Co-authored-by: Antoine Rybacki <[email protected]>
@GabrielBoninUnity
Copy link
Contributor Author

Propositions have been updated. Thanks!

@Lifeismana
Copy link
Collaborator

Lifeismana commented Jun 6, 2024

https://steamdb.info/app/945360/ https://steamdb.info/app/307950/ https://steamdb.info/app/570460/ https://steamdb.info/app/1446230/ https://steamdb.info/app/1487390/ https://steamdb.info/app/1359390/ https://steamdb.info/app/581320/

Just checking things before merging but none of these apps are using Unity Multiplay, are you sure this list is correct ?

Also, i'll note that Gang beast 285900 is a false positive, the multiplay dll is only in the mac os build but nothing much we can do about that

@Lifeismana Lifeismana changed the title add unity multiplay sdk Add Unity Multiplay sdk Jun 6, 2024
@GabrielBoninUnity
Copy link
Contributor Author

GabrielBoninUnity commented Jun 6, 2024

https://steamdb.info/app/945360/ https://steamdb.info/app/307950/ https://steamdb.info/app/570460/ https://steamdb.info/app/1446230/ https://steamdb.info/app/1487390/ https://steamdb.info/app/1359390/ https://steamdb.info/app/581320/

Just checking things before merging but none of these apps are using Unity Multiplay, are you sure this list is correct ?

Also, i'll note that Gang beast 285900 is a false positive, the multiplay dll is only in the mac os build but nothing much we can do about that

Will talk to the team and get back to you next week. thanks

@GabrielBoninUnity
Copy link
Contributor Author

Hey Lifeismana,

I chatted with the team and learned that some of our customers using Unity and Unreal Engine built their own interfaces for the Multiplay services. Because of this, when these games are compiled, they don’t produce a file that the regex can detect since they’re pinging the API directly.

However, games that install the SDK package directly and don’t use a custom interface do produce the file that the regex picks up. Even though we can’t capture all games since detecting multiplayer SDKs is a bit more complex, we still think keeping the regex in SteamDB is valuable. Do you have any thoughts?

Thanks

@Lifeismana
Copy link
Collaborator

Indeed, it's still worth it to merge it.
Cool to know the reason behind that

@GabrielBoninUnity
Copy link
Contributor Author

Indeed, it's still worth it to merge it. Cool to know the reason behind that

Anytime! Thanks for merging it

@Lifeismana Lifeismana merged commit 5115665 into SteamDatabase:main Jun 12, 2024
2 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ants